Transistors - Bipolar (BJT) - Single, Pre-Biased

Category Introduction

Pre-biased bipolar transistors have internal resistors designed to maintain the device near the bias or operating point with no input signal applied. Transistor biasing allows the transistor to work more efficiently and produce a stable, undistorted output signal. Pre-biased transistors reduce the number of external circuit components required, thereby reducing project costs.

About Single Pre-Biased Bipolar Transistors

What are Single Pre-Biased Bipolar Transistors?

Single Pre-Biased Bipolar Transistors

Single Pre-Biased Bipolar Transistors are a specialized category of bipolar junction transistors (BJTs) that come with built-in biasing resistors. These transistors simplify circuit design by eliminating the need for external biasing components, thereby reducing the number of components and saving space on the circuit board. They operate on the principle of controlling current flow through a semiconductor material, using a small input current at the base to control a larger output current between the collector and emitter. This makes them ideal for switching and amplification applications, where they can efficiently manage current flow with minimal external components.

Types of Single Pre-Biased Bipolar Transistors

NPN Pre-Biased Transistors

NPN Pre-Biased Transistors are designed with a negative-positive-negative configuration and are commonly used in applications where the load is connected to the collector. They are ideal for high-speed switching and amplification tasks, offering low saturation voltage and high current gain. Their built-in resistors simplify the biasing process, making them suitable for digital circuits and microcontroller interfaces.

How to choose Single Pre-Biased Bipolar Transistors?

When selecting Single Pre-Biased Bipolar Transistors, several key parameters must be considered:

  • Current Rating: Ensure the transistor can handle the maximum current required by your application.
  • Voltage Rating: Choose a transistor with a voltage rating that exceeds the maximum voltage in your circuit.
  • Gain (hFE): Select a transistor with an appropriate gain for your amplification needs.
  • Package Type: Consider the physical size and thermal characteristics of the transistor package.
  • Environmental Factors: Evaluate the operating temperature range and humidity tolerance.

To assess product quality and reliability, review supplier datasheets for detailed specifications and test results. Consider suppliers with a proven track record and positive customer feedback. Additionally, ensure the transistor is compatible with your circuit's installation requirements, such as through-hole or surface-mount technology.

Applications of Single Pre-Biased Bipolar Transistors

Consumer Electronics

In consumer electronics, Single Pre-Biased Bipolar Transistors are used in devices such as televisions, radios, and smartphones for signal amplification and switching. Their compact design and integrated biasing resistors make them ideal for space-constrained applications.

Automotive Industry

These transistors are employed in automotive electronics for tasks such as controlling lighting systems, managing power distribution, and interfacing with sensors. Their reliability and efficiency are crucial in the demanding automotive environment.

Industrial Automation

In industrial automation, Single Pre-Biased Bipolar Transistors are used in control systems, motor drives, and sensor interfaces. Their ability to handle high currents and voltages makes them suitable for robust industrial applications.

Telecommunications

Telecommunications equipment relies on these transistors for signal processing and amplification. Their high-speed switching capabilities are essential for maintaining signal integrity in communication networks.

Medical Devices

In medical devices, Single Pre-Biased Bipolar Transistors are used for signal conditioning and control circuits. Their precision and reliability are vital for ensuring the accurate operation of diagnostic and monitoring equipment.
